public class CSVImporterOptions extends Object implements Serializable
Modifier and Type | Class and Description |
---|---|
static class |
CSVImporterOptions.Builder |
Modifier and Type | Field and Description |
---|---|
protected int |
batchSize |
protected boolean |
checkAllowedSubTypes |
protected CSVImporterDocumentFactory |
CSVImporterDocumentFactory |
protected String |
dateFormat |
static CSVImporterOptions |
DEFAULT_OPTIONS |
protected Character |
escapeCharacter |
protected String |
listSeparatorRegex |
protected boolean |
sendEmail |
protected boolean |
updateExisting |
Modifier | Constructor and Description |
---|---|
protected |
CSVImporterOptions(CSVImporterDocumentFactory CSVImporterDocumentFactory,
String dateFormat,
String listSeparatorRegex,
boolean updateExisting,
boolean checkAllowedSubTypes,
boolean sendEmail,
int batchSize) |
protected |
CSVImporterOptions(CSVImporterDocumentFactory CSVImporterDocumentFactory,
String dateFormat,
String listSeparatorRegex,
Character escapeCharacter,
boolean updateExisting,
boolean checkAllowedSubTypes,
boolean sendEmail,
int batchSize) |
Modifier and Type | Method and Description |
---|---|
boolean |
checkAllowedSubTypes() |
int |
getBatchSize() |
CSVImporterDocumentFactory |
getCSVImporterDocumentFactory() |
String |
getDateFormat() |
Character |
getEscapeCharacter() |
String |
getListSeparatorRegex() |
boolean |
sendEmail() |
boolean |
updateExisting() |
public static final CSVImporterOptions DEFAULT_OPTIONS
protected final CSVImporterDocumentFactory CSVImporterDocumentFactory
protected final String dateFormat
protected final String listSeparatorRegex
protected final Character escapeCharacter
protected final boolean updateExisting
protected final boolean checkAllowedSubTypes
protected final boolean sendEmail
protected final int batchSize
protected CSVImporterOptions(CSVImporterDocumentFactory CSVImporterDocumentFactory, String dateFormat, String listSeparatorRegex, boolean updateExisting, boolean checkAllowedSubTypes, boolean sendEmail, int batchSize)
protected CSVImporterOptions(CSVImporterDocumentFactory CSVImporterDocumentFactory, String dateFormat, String listSeparatorRegex, Character escapeCharacter, boolean updateExisting, boolean checkAllowedSubTypes, boolean sendEmail, int batchSize)
public CSVImporterDocumentFactory getCSVImporterDocumentFactory()
public String getDateFormat()
public String getListSeparatorRegex()
public Character getEscapeCharacter()
public boolean updateExisting()
public boolean checkAllowedSubTypes()
public boolean sendEmail()
public int getBatchSize()
Copyright © 2015 Nuxeo SA. All rights reserved.